i started getting into offroad belive it or not with a 2wd..... i had a 2001 nissan xterra the end of my junior year in high school. bought a t case and had almost everything for a 4wd swap other than the trans. i was planning on doing the 4 link calamini kit with a 44 but moved on to something else after i lifted it 3'' with 32 ats



after a few more cars i traded a bronco for a xj that needed a lot of work and the back was destroyed so i decided to do some cutting :roll:



and it continued. i got some mickey thompson classic IIs and some mix match 33s threw a 4.5'' lift togther with some bastard packs and a little block to get by, rustys coils, and just rustys lower short arm.... rode like s**t. by the way this was not a dd



and more... put long arms on it and 6.5 coils with a welded 8.8 and i had just destroyed the 3rd front end

in the mean time i picked up another cherokee for $200 and did a lot of work to it and still am. its a 91 cherokee auto 4x4 242 tcase i put some 235/75r15 as soon as i got it because the tires were shot



picked up a 3'' skyjacker lift with a spacer and shackle so it ended up being a 4'' lift, currie steering, and a few other goods.

threw some 31s on it and started driving it



got a roof rack, swapped in a rear dana 44, orfab front bumper with a winch, and an aussie front and rear locker



http://a6.sphotos.ak.fbcdn.net/hphotos-ak-snc4/73464_480337971239_543791239_6813251_812487_n.jpg

having two rigs got a little pricey and well got tired of that worn out unibody so yeah



time to move on
decided to convert to one jeep. sold a bunch off the old one and put a lot on the new xj
long arms, picked up some 6.5 leaves for the rear. extended brakelines, swapped in a 231 with a sye, front alloy dif cover, picked up some 33 bfg ats for the street, the works
